Kaali Venkat's next titled Appane Muruga

The film went on floors in Chennai on Thursday with a pooja ceremony.

Actor Kaali Venkat, who was last seen in Kamalakannan's Kurangu Pedal, is all set to headline his next titled Appane Muruga. The film will be directed by debut filmmaker Guru Ramasamy, who has previously worked as co-director to Late director Rasu Madhuravan. Appane Muruga went on floors in Chennai on Thursday with a pooja ceremony.

Apart from Kaali Venkat, the film also stars Saravanan, MS Bhaskar, Munishkanth, Madhumitha, Janaki, Super Good Subramani, Mohana Sundaram and Pudhuvai Boopalan of Taanakaaran fame, among others.

The story revolves around a man, who has lost his life's earnings, due to his to online gambling. How he gets out of troubled waters with his effort and hardwork, thereby redeeming his lost happiness forms the crux of this story.

On the technical crew, the film has cinematography by Jaya Prakash, who has previously cranked the camera for the critically acclaimed film Kidaa. It has editing handled by Ramar and stunts by Elango. The film is produced by R Sathish Thangam, RG Sekar and Sasikumar of True Team Entertainment. The next schedule of filming for Appane Muruga will take place in Ambasamudram, Pollachi, and Kerala.

A release date is yet to be announced by the makers.
